About 10 Eccleston Road

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

10 Eccleston Road is a three-bedroom detached house in Higher Kinnerton, Chester, Chester (CH4 9DY). It has a recorded floor area of 81 m² (around 872 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1983-1990 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(June 2024) shows a C (score 74). When first surveyed in June 2011 the rating was E,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Good to Very Good,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good and lighting went from Good to Very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 88). Other recorded features include a conservatory.

It hasn't traded since July 2000, a hold of 26 years that's notably long for the area. Across 1998–2000, sale prices on this property compounded at 10.4%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£304,000 sits 257.6% above the 2000 sale of £85,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£97/sq ft) was about 50.5% below the postcode norm. At 81 m² it's 22.1%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(104 m² median across 19 EPCs).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 74% of similar EPCs).
